Ticket: Staging env misconfigured for Siftgate bloom filter

The bloom layer in front of the Pellet KV store is rejecting all lookups in staging because the env file was copied from the dev template without credentials. False-positive tuning values are fine; only the auth line is missing. To unblock the weekly demo, the Pellet admission secret must be set on the following line.

env line for yaguf-fajop: LEDGER_TOKEN13=fb08984397349

**Action item (INC-validator-overload, owner: Platform):** Harden the Siftgate plugin loader. Root cause: a third-party validator plugin ran unbounded regex checks, starving the ingest pool. Fix: enforce per-plugin execution budgets and a circuit breaker that disables misbehaving validators after repeated timeouts. New team members: plugins are untrusted code; never raise these limits for a single tenant without review. Budgets and breaker thresholds are defined by the constants below.

tuning table, yajog-yahof:
BUDGETS = {
    "lamvan": 303,
    "wenox": 460,
    "fenvan": 525,
}

Welcome to the Keyline reset-flow revamp. Scope: replace the legacy email-token flow with short-lived signed links and a rate-limited verification step. Code lives in the auth-reset repo; staging runs against the Harbrook identity sandbox. Do not touch the legacy handlers — they stay live until cutover. Read the design brief first, then pick tasks tagged contractor-ready. Deploys go through the release captain. Questions on access, environments, or scope go to the project lead.

escalation mailbox, bafog-fafog: ulador@paliqlabs.internal

## Releases: clock skew

Build agents in the Harlowe pool drifted up to 40s last sprint, which broke timestamp validation on Quillbox release artifacts twice. NTP sync now runs pre-build; any agent skewed more than 2s is pulled from rotation automatically. If a release fails with a timestamp error anyway, rebuild — don't override. Signed artifacts must carry a monotonic build time or the Ferncastle verifier rejects them. For manual re-signing during the sync window, use the key below.

deploy key for kahof-tadup: bky4_rRMZ